Media and public relations manager

Mizzi Studio is looking for a talented, well-connected media and public relations manager to join its vibrant London-based team.

About Mizzi Studio

We are an award-winning design studio working on projects ranging from architecture to industrial, lighting, interactive design and commercial artworks.  We specialise in sculptural, futuristic, and organically-inspired multi-disciplinary design, work within some of London’s most prominent sites and have a diverse portfolio of reputable clients.

The role will cover all activity related to media coverage, liaison and management – including social media, print and digital press, and media-related events. We are looking for someone who has two+ years working in the architecture and design industry, robust knowledge of the architecture/design press, substantial experience dealing with PR professionals and journalists, and a sound track-record of delivering captivating social media content.  They should be able to produce exceptional copy for all content related to press, with a keen eye for detail and superb editing skills.

Applicants should be confident working autonomously, able to manage all media activities internally, as well as liaise with the studio’s external consultants.  They should have impeccable copywriting.

Your main responsibilities will include:

  • producing copy for project descriptions, press releases, social media, newsletters, award submissions, and media pitches
  • crafting press strategies both on a studio-wide level, and on a project-by-project basis
  • crafting social media strategies with measurable audience-reaching goals
  • building and up-keep of a strong, wide-reaching press contacts database
  • maintaining good relationships with all press contacts and managing media liaison in a timely manner
  • identifying public relations opportunities for the studio’s director and senior designers – including lectures, fairs, networking events and so on
  • keeping on top of industry award submission dates, identifying projects to enter, and putting together strong submissions
  • maintaining up-to-date press packs for each of the studio’s projects, including text descriptions, press-ready drawings, and adequate photographs or visualisations
  • maintaining and updating the studio’s digital and physical press archive
  • conducting market research with a view to grow media and networking opportunities for the studio

Your skills should include:

  • two+ years working in a similar role within an architectural or design practice
  • excellent written and verbal English
  • strong communication and collaborative skills
  • ability to work with a remote team including external consultants when required
  • ability to deliver results against multiple deadlines across numerous projects
  • ability to keep on top of current design trends and movements
  • excellent kn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ite software
  • good knowledge of Adobe Suite software – specifically InDesign
  • keen interest in architecture and design
